April 10th, 2017, I attended the Memorial Service / Celebration of Life for my dear friend, Kimberly Dawn Skinner. In the nine days between her passing and her service, I felt the world grow so much more cold, dim, and dull than it ever had been. But on April 10th, her family had set out a binder containing her bucket list. I was holding back tears that day, but I couldn’t stop myself from smiling while I read that list. Every line reminded me more and more of what the world lost, but it was her. Right there on that paper was a better description of who she was than I or anyone else could ever hope to give outside the length of a college lecture. That list reminded me that Kim’s life was a constant adventure that she shared with everyone she met. Her family asked us to continue her adventures by picking something from her bucket list and just doing it, but I know Kim would have wanted everyone to have an adventure of their own at some point in their life - not just the people who were fortunate enough to meet her.
Here’s Kim’s list. Read it. Pick something, accomplish it, come back and share your story with us. Maybe you’ll give a bouquet of flowers to a stranger and you’ll end up finding your soulmate. Maybe you’ll visit a theme park and ride everything (kid shit included) and realise that growing old is inevitable, but growing up isn’t. That’s for you to decide, her list is only for inspiration.
